21xrx.com
2024-12-23 00:13:33 Monday
登录
文章检索 我的文章 写文章
C语言中的Link错误和如何解决
2023-06-16 20:11:01 深夜i     --     --
C语言 Link错误 编译

在C语言编程过程中,有时候会遇到Link错误,一般出现在链接阶段。Link错误是指在编译代码时,由于缺少某个链接库或链接库版本不兼容等原因造成的编译错误。那么,我们该如何解决Link错误呢?

一般来说,解决Link错误有以下几种方法:

1.检查函数声明和定义

在C语言中,函数声明和定义必须匹配,否则会造成Link错误。因此,我们需要确保所有函数声明和定义都是正确的。

2.添加必要的头文件

在C语言中,头文件用于声明函数、变量和宏等。如果遗漏了某些必要的头文件,也会造成Link错误。因此,我们需要确保所有必要的头文件都被添加到程序中。

3.链接正确的库文件

当我们使用一些外部库时,需要将其链接到我们的程序中。如果链接的库文件版本不兼容或无效,也会造成Link错误。因此,我们需要确保链接正确的库文件。

总的来说,Link错误是C语言编程中常见的编译错误之一。我们可以通过检查函数声明和定义、添加必要的头文件和链接正确的库文件等方法来解决Link错误。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复